[QUOTE="mxmarkargent, post: 1699419, member: 6446"] I think the only reason they used the word "medieval" is to emphasize that Eberron is not a setting where you can get +1 flintlocks. Yes there are knighthoods and monarchies in Eberron, but there are knighthoods and monarchies in the 21st century, too. There are obvious parallels to be drawn between Eberron and Earth post-WWI, but there are other parallels that can be drawn to the Enlightenment and the Renaissance. One of the exciting things about Eberron is that it's a world on the brink of a lot of massive changes. It's a medieval world in many ways, but it won't stay that way for long. The Treaty of Thronehold is as much the Magna Carta as it is the Treaty of Versailles. The three remaining monarchies of Khorvaire are all unstable in one way or another -- the only reason they're still around is that there haven't been any revolutions...yet. Artificers, magewrights, the lightning rail, and warforged are all relatively recent developments, and where one development occurs, others follow shortly. Their (arcano-)industrial revolution hasn't happened yet, but it's on its way. In fact, the key phrase behind Eberron is "it hasn't happened yet". But it will. Eberron hasn't found its Cromwell, its Da Vinci or Galileo, its Martin Luther, Ben Franklin or Thomas Jefferson...but it will. That's what the PCs are there for. This is one of the major appeal Eberron has for me. Many of the old TSR settings felt static to me, like the big stories had already been told and the PCs weren't included. Eberron is at the beginning of the story. Those thousands of years of history described in the book? That's the title crawl. That's over. Time for your story. [/QUOTE]
